WebOnsite wastewater treatment refers to a conventional septic tank system or alternative system installed at a site to treat and dispose of wastewater, predominantly of human origin, generated at that site. ADEQ has authority for issuing permits for operating these systems. WebIn Iowa, local boards of health have primary responsibility for regulation of onsite wastewater treatment systems (also known as a private sewage disposal systems) serving 4 homes or fewer or less than 15 people, while the Iowa DNR has primary responsibility for larger (public) systems. Web15 de nov. de 2016 · The Homeowner’s Guide to Alternative Septic Systems. When you live in a rural or suburban home that can’t be connected to the municipal sewer system, installing a septic tank seems like the obvious choice. For as practical as septic systems are, though, they don’t work in every situation.
